LOUISVILLE, Ky. (Aug. 14, 2008) - Mayor Jerry Abramson hosted a ribbon-cutting ceremony, along with 3rd District Congressman John Yarmuth and J.C.P.S. Superintendent Sheldon Berman, announcing the Youth Opportunities Unlimited (Y.O.U.) Center’s new location at 981 South 3rd Street—more than doubling in size with over 8,000 sq. ft. Formerly located at 200 West Broadway, the Y.O.U. Center provides an array of free services to enhance job seekers’ academic and job readiness skills for youth ages 16-21.LOUISVILLE, Ky.
